Allele D produced tiny ears, and allele d produces normal ones. If a heterozygous male with Dd mates with the homozygous female with dd, then generally, the expected offspring produced will be 50 percent with tiny ears, and 50 percent with normal ears.
However, in the given case, the penetrance is 70 percent. Thus, the probability of the offspring with tiny ears will be:
Penetrance = 70 %
Probability = 70 % of 50 % of 100
= 70/100 * 50/100 * 100
= 35 %
Hence, the probability of the offspring with tiny ears is 35%.

This question involves a single gene coding for seed color in pea plants. The allele for green seeds (G) is dominant over the allele for yellow seeds (g). This means that a plant that is heterozygous (Gg) will possess green seeds.
If two parents are about to cross in such a way that Parent 1 is homo-zygous for green seeds i.e. GG, while Parent 2 is homo-zygous for yellow seeds i.e. gg.
- Parent 1 (GG) will produce only "G" gametes
- Parent 2 (gg) will produce only "g" gametes

e autonomic nervous system also called the vegetative nervous system is part of the peripheral nervous system which inervates smooth muscle and glands. Thus, it directly affects the function of internal organs and regulates functions such as the heart rate, digestion, respiratory rate, urination etc. This nervous system control is unconscious.
The autonomic nervous system is divided into: the sympathetic nervous system, the parasympathetic nervous system and the enteric nervous system.
Parasympathetic nervous system works when organism is at rest so it is known as system responsible for "rest and digest functions". On the other hand, sympathetic nervous system works at active and stressful situations and it is known as "fight and flight" system.
